Responsiveness Evaluation Index for an Excavator Operation Based on Control Engineering Approach

Abstract

Some industrial equipments are required by the human operation such as bulldozers, excavators and cranes. Construction machines with better operability are necessary to improve productivity. Evaluations of those operational equipments are performed to obtain the better operability by subjective evaluations of the specific evaluator at the design stage. However, subjective evaluations require the skill of evaluator or a lot of sample data. In this paper, relationships between approximated parameters expressed as a low order system and subjective evaluations are verified by using the Weber-Fechner law. The evaluated motion is the boom up motion for an excavator. The simulator for the boom motion has been made because the real excavator has the limited condition. Therefore, the evaluation is performed numerically and experimentally. Approximated system parameters for the real excavator are calculated by the genetic algorithm.
